Output 121caf4531120cb5a9c58f03cca4eddee59e6e264f863f2692d2b8dbce1b692c:2

value
584832194
script pubkey
OP_0 OP_PUSHBYTES_20 79e4c6ea2d35b7ca9ae553c1faed617f8cf58ac5
address
bc1q08jvd63dxkmu4xh920ql4mtp07x0tzk9dntdmc
transaction
121caf4531120cb5a9c58f03cca4eddee59e6e264f863f2692d2b8dbce1b692c
spent
true